Originally released in 1963. April is a romance/comedy film. directed by Otar Iosseliani. At just 47 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.

Starring Tatyana Chanturia, Gia Chiraqadze, and Akakiy Chikvaidze

Synopsis

A critique of materialism, the film is about a young couple who live in a rundown empty apartment. Their love is so strong that it makes the water flow and the electricity work, but when they start purchasing furniture and knickknacks, they fight and grow apart.
